Have you ever wondered how prepared you were for college or the real world? Well, it may shock you to realize that by going to high school online you are preparing for a successful future already. California is in the process of requiring every high school student to take at least one online course. Why do you think it is so important that high school students experience an online classroom? Well, thirty percent of all college students will take at least one online course and this number is rising each year. The transition from in person to online can be detrimental to some and if your first experience is when you are thrown into it in college it can be daunting and leave the students feeling all alone. College professors don’t walk students through the process of online courses. However, if you have knowledge of how to learn online, submit work online, ask teachers for help, and collaborate with other students online you are way ahead of the game. You are setting yourself up for success in college.

What about Beyond College?

How does doing high school online prepare you for the working world? Almost every job requires some knowledge of how to use a computer. Whether you need to be versed in how to us Word, Excel, type fast on the keyboard or just know how to answer emails, using a computer has become a common occurrence in the work place. Learning online every day can increase your knowledge of how programs work, you will become more proficient using the keyboard and you will become faster at navigating through the web.
